2010 Boys' Youth South American Volleyball Championship
| Tournament details | |
|---|---|
| Host nation | Venezuela | 
| Dates | April 12–16 | 
| Teams | 6 | 
| Venue(s) | 1 (in 1 host city) | 
| Champions | Argentina (2nd title) | 
| Tournament awards | |
| MVP | Gonzalo Quiroga | 
The 2010 Boys' Youth South American Volleyball Championship was the 17th edition of the tournament, organised by South America's governing volleyball body, the Confederación Sudamericana de Voleibol (CSV) for Under-19 teams. It was held in Venezuela. The top national team other than Argentina qualified to the 2011 Youth World Championship, Argentina had already secured a berth as Host.
